Funding for "Advancing Supervision for Artistic Research Doctorates" project
News September 21, 2018Orpheus Institute engages in Erasmus+ strategic partnership for higher education (2018-2021)
The Orpheus Institute and eight other European institutions join forces in a 3-year multi-disciplinary Erasmus+ project. The strategic partnership project "Advancing Supervision for Artistic Research Doctorates" was awarded funding from the Erasmus+ programme of the European Union.
Advancing Supervision for Artistic Research Doctorates aims to improve doctoral education at art universities. It addresses doctoral supervision as the core component in doctoral education, proposing a balanced set of measures to improve supervision on a practical level (addressing institutions and students), a strategic level (addressing membership organisations), and on an advocacy level (addressing stakeholders and policy makers). The members of the project consortium, led by the Academy of Fine Arts Vienna, come from all artistic fields (fine arts, media arts, performative arts, architecture and design, music, art theory) ensuring a transnational and transdisciplinary perspective of supervision in artistic research.
The Orpheus Institute has several years of experience on this topic by coordinating the docARTES doctoral programme and is looking forward to the results of this partnership.
Coordinator:
Akademie der Bildenden Künste Wien (Austria)
Partners:
- Akademie výtvarných umění v Praze (Czech Republic)
- Universitetet i Bergen (Norway)
- Arkitektskolen Aarhus (Denmark)
- The Glasgow School of Art (United Kingdom)
- European League of Institutes of the Arts (Netherlands)
- Zürcher Hochschule der Künste (Switzerland)
- Universität für künstlerische und industrielle Gestaltung Linz (Austria)
- Orpheus Instituut (Belgium)
